Dauntless & Relentless

Samuel and Samantha Capote were raised in an internment camp, their gene-markers designating them as Alpha-class mutants. In their reality, mutants were less than animals, a slave-race to serve the more genetically “pure” Homo sapiens, the “saps,” as mutants called them in secret. Unfortunately, when the mutant birthrate exploded despite the birth control regulations and genetic-screening programs, the govern­ment began culling the internment camps. They planned to terminate mutants until their numbers were brought to more “reasonable” levels.   The twins joined the mutant resistance using the code-names Dauntless and Relentless and participated in the revolt that lib­erated the camps and turned the war on mutants around. They were winning, slowly, but surely, they were winning. Then the govern­ment released the Dever Virus, which targeted the mutant gene and unraveled the genetic code, resulting in a painful and slow death.   The mutant population was decimated, but then, so were the humans. The world was on the cusp of an evolutionary shift, and many humans carried recessive mutant genes that escaped the crude screening process, but not the virus. Their world was dying, and the blame fell on the “mutant terrorists” rather than the real cul­prits.   Samuel and Samantha avoided infec­tion, but with so many falling to the virus and the extermination squads, they knew it would only be a matter of time before they made their last stand. Fortunately, that’s when Navagatrix appeared. Its entry flash drew the military’s attention, and it was only the timely intervention of Relentless and Dauntless that saved the con­struct from capture. In gratitude, Navigatrix provided them with safe passage from their dimension, thus beginning The AlterniTeens.   After a harrowing ride through different realities, Relentless and Dauntless finally feel free of their world’s horrible legacy. They’re putting their past behind them and adjusting to life in the wonder­fully liberated (and aptly named) Freedom City. Dauntless is attracted to Seven, and even though he knows she isn’t interested in him, he thinks persistence will eventually win her over. Relentless, however, is finding herself attracted to Neried, and she is wrestling with questions about her sexuality.
